Overview

Coriolis Ventures is a venture capital firm co-founded by Joshua Abram and Alan Murray, who have collaborated for over 20 years. Based in the United States, the firm focuses on early-stage investments, particularly in healthcare, biotech, and consumer sectors. Their portfolio includes companies with a combined market value exceeding $5 billion as of December 2021.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is Coriolis Ventures' investment focus?

Coriolis Ventures primarily invests in early-stage companies, emphasizing disruptive technologies, especially in the fertility sector.

What stages does Coriolis Ventures invest in?

The firm invests at the pre-seed, seed, and seed-plus stages, providing initial capital to startups.

What notable exits has Coriolis Ventures achieved?

Successful exits include acquisitions by major firms such as AT&T, Expedia, and Greenthumb.
